<br />Lexington Board of Health Meeting, May 14, 2008 at 7:00 p.m. <br />Town Office Building, Room 111 <br />1625 Massachusetts Avenue, Lexington, MA <br /> <br />Attendees: Wendy Heiger-Bernays, Chair; Burt Perlmutter; Judith Feldman; <br />Sharon MacKenzie; Deborah Thompson <br /> <br />Health Department Attendees: Gerard F. Cody, Ann Belliveau <br /> <br />Heiger-Bernays called the meeting to order at 7:05 p.m. <br /> <br />The Board reviewed the minutes of April 19, 2008. Perlmutter motioned to accept the <br />minutes of April 19, 2008 as amended. MacKenzie seconded. All approved. <br /> <br />The Board reviewed the Public Health Nurse report. <br /> <br />Food Code Compliance Program Update <br /> <br />The Board reviewed the April 2008 Food Inspection Report. <br /> <br />Pool Permit Variance Requests <br /> <br />Five Fields Pool, Pool and Spa at Quality Inn Suites, Paint Rock Pool and Moon Hill <br />Community Pool submitted letters to the Board requesting variances. Perlmutter <br />motioned to grant the appropriate variances requested by these pools, pending proper <br />signage. MacKenzie seconded. All approved. <br /> <br />Cody recommended creating a single program for granting variances at one time. <br /> <br />Community Health Update/Reports <br /> <br />The Board reviewed the Community Health Reports. Cody mentioned the VMBIP will <br />begin on June 23, 2008, and the Health Department will no longer be distributing vaccine <br />for children and it will all be handled by McKesson which is a nation-wide vaccine <br />distributor. <br /> <br />Cody advised the Board that the Town of Belmont made a few administrative changes to <br />the Public Health Nurse Agreement. The agreement will need to be reviewed by <br />Lexington’s Town Counsel, and then the position will be advertised. <br /> <br />Cody informed the Board that since the first medical waste day was so successful with <br />approximately 80 participants, a second collection is scheduled to take place on <br />Wednesday evening in June at the same location behind the Town Office Building. <br /> <br />Environmental Health Report <br /> <br />Housing Code Compliance Program Update <br /> <br />9 Stimson Avenue – Cody opened the hearing concerning housing issues at 9 Stimson <br />Avenue. Cody introduced the owner and resident of the property, Leslie Bonini to the <br />Board. The Animal Control Officer notified Cody of a call received from the moving <br />company doing work at 9 Stimson Avenue because they wanted to bring to the attention <br />of the ACO because a dead cat was in the refrigerator. Ms. Bonini let the Health Director <br />and Environmental Agent into her home to perform a State Sanitary Code Inspection. <br /> <br />
